GENERAL INSTRUCTIONS
These instructions should be read carefully and retained after installation by the end user for future reference and maintenance. These instructions should be used to aid installation of the following products: AMLEDWP / AMLEDBP
SAFETY
• This product must be installed in accordance with the latest edition of the IEE Wiring Regulations (BS7671) and current Building Regulations. If in any doubt, consult a qualified electrician
• Please isolate mains prior to installation or maintenance
• Check the total load on the circuit (including when this luminaire is fitted) does not exceed the rating of the circuit cable, fuse or circuit breaker
• Please note the IP (Ingress Protection) rating of this product when deciding the location for installation
• This product is Class II double insulated
• This product is IP54 rated
INSTALLATION
• Provide power to the required point of installation (refer to BS7671 for correct cabling methods). Suitable IP rated junction boxes should be used where required
• Remove the diffuser and gear tray from the body
• Drill the fixing holes in the rear of the fitting. Mark the location of the fixing holes and drill ensuring not to infringe with any gas/water pipes or electrical cables
• Drill out one of the 20mm drilling guides on the fitting, and fit a suitable external grommet or compression gland (not included)
• Connect the luminaire to the mains supply ensuring the correct polarity is observed: L - Live (brown),
N - Neutral (blue) (see Fig. 1)

Please note: the sensor fitted to this luminaire can differentiate between natural daylight and artificial light, and will only be activated by natural daylight.
WARNING
This product must be disconnected from the circuit if subjected to any high voltage or insulation resistance testing. Irreparable damage will occur if this instruction is not followed.

GENERAL
This product contains a light source of energy efficiency class E to Regulation (EU) No. 2019/2015.
This product contains an LED light source which can be replaced by the end user and a control gear which can be replaced by a professional.

Clean the external surfaces with a damp cloth using a mild solution of detergent and warm water only, do not use aggressive cleaning products or solvents which may damage the product. Do not use any source of high-pressure washers to maintain or clean this luminaire. This product is non-dimmable. This product should be dismantled for disposal when it reaches the end of its life. Please see website for dismantling instructions. This product should be recycled in the correct manner when it reaches the end of its life. Check local authorities for where facilities exist.
